Technological Continuity: DWG Compatibility and Seamless Integration

One of the main reasons why nanoCAD became the ideal platform for our team is its full compatibility with the DWG format. We were able to immediately start working with existing documentation without having to convert files or change the project structure. This ensured the continuity of processes and allowed us to preserve the entire previously developed array of drawings and standards without adaptation losses. Moreover, nanoCAD correctly interprets data created in other CAD environments, which is critical when working with contractors and related departments.

nanoCAD Mechanica Module: Engineering Power in Action

The nanoCAD Mechanica module deserves special attention, as it provides a powerful arsenal of tools for engineers. We actively use it when developing drawings of equipment, supporting structures, flange connections and other elements of HVAC systems. The presence of a built-in library of GOST and ISO standards, automatic creation of specifications, designations, as well as the integration of engineering calculations make this module not just convenient, but truly necessary in everyday practice. With its help, it was possible to achieve standardization of design documentation and minimize the number of manual errors.
